How to Balance Artistic Vision with Client Expectations in Creative Projects
In the world of creative management, one of the biggest challenges is balancing the artistic vision of the creator with the client's expectations. Both are essential to the success of any project, but they often come into conflict. The Role of Creative Managers: Finding the Sweet Spot
As creative managers, we serve as the mediators between two worlds: the artist’s unique expression and the client's vision of what they need to achieve their goals. This mediation is delicate but vital. The artist wants to bring something authentic, expressive, and boundary-pushing to the table, while the client may be focused on more practical outcomes like branding consistency, marketability, and audience appeal.
At WieManage, we know that the key to successful creative projects lies in open communication and mutual respect. When both sides understand each other's priorities, a middle ground can be found that not only satisfies but also elevates the project.
Strategies to Maintain Balance
1. Collaborative Briefing and Goal-Setting:
From the start, we ensure that both artist and client are aligned on the project’s objectives. We create collaborative project briefs that allow both parties to voice their goals. This open dialogue ensures the artist can understand the business priorities, and the client can appreciate the creative possibilities.
2. Educating Both Sides:
Part of our job is to educate both the client and the artist. Clients often need to see how pushing creative boundaries can actually enhance their brand or project. Likewise, artists may need guidance on how to stay within the project's scope while still expressing their vision. By bridging this gap, we help both sides understand how to approach the project from a balanced perspective.
3. Prototyping and Flexibility:
WieManage often encourages a phased approach to creative projects. Prototypes, sketches, or drafts allow clients to provide feedback early, and artists can adjust accordingly without compromising their vision. This iterative approach helps maintain flexibility while ensuring everyone is on the same page.
4. Balancing Creativity and Marketability:
While the artist's work must remain authentic, it also needs to serve the practical needs of the client. We work closely with both parties to ensure that creativity doesn’t sacrifice marketability. For example, if an artist’s original vision might be too avant-garde for a client’s target audience, we find ways to adapt the project without losing its artistic edge. Often, this involves subtle adjustments rather than sweeping changes.
